基于指定关键词的网页跳转代码实现详解
图片来源于网络,如有侵权联系删除
一、引言
随着互联网技术的飞速发展,网页跳转已成为网站开发中常见的需求,为了提高用户体验,简化操作流程,基于指定关键词的网页跳转代码应运而生,本文将详细介绍如何实现这一功能,以帮助开发者更好地掌握相关技术。
二、技术原理
基于指定关键词的网页跳转代码主要利用JavaScript技术实现,通过在HTML页面中添加JavaScript代码,根据用户输入的关键词动态地改变当前页面的URL,实现页面跳转。
三、实现步骤
1. 创建HTML页面
我们需要创建一个HTML页面,用于展示输入框和跳转按钮,以下是一个简单的示例:
```html
```
2. 编写JavaScript代码
在上面的HTML页面中,我们添加了一个名为`keywordJump`的JavaScript函数,该函数获取用户输入的关键词,并将其与URL拼接后赋值给`window.location.href`,从而实现页面跳转。
3. 部署网页
将上述代码保存为HTML文件,并上传到服务器,在浏览器中打开该网页,输入关键词并点击跳转按钮,即可实现基于指定关键词的网页跳转。
四、优化与扩展
1. 添加错误处理
在实际应用中,可能会遇到用户输入无效关键词的情况,为了提高用户体验,我们可以在JavaScript代码中添加错误处理逻辑:
```javascript
function keywordJump() {
var keyword = document.getElementById("keyword").value;
图片来源于网络,如有侵权联系删除
if (keyword.trim() === "") {
alert("请输入关键词!");
return;
}
window.location.href = "http://www.example.com/search?q=" + keyword;
```
2. 动态生成URL
为了提高代码的灵活性,我们可以将URL的生成逻辑提取出来,形成一个单独的函数:
```javascript
function generateSearchUrl(keyword) {
return "http://www.example.com/search?q=" + keyword;
function keywordJump() {
var keyword = document.getElementById("keyword").value;
if (keyword.trim() === "") {
alert("请输入关键词!");
return;
}
var searchUrl = generateSearchUrl(keyword);
window.location.href = searchUrl;
```
3. 集成搜索功能
在实际应用中,我们可能需要将关键词跳转功能与搜索功能集成,以下是一个简单的示例:
图片来源于网络,如有侵权联系删除
```html
```
五、总结
本文详细介绍了基于指定关键词的网页跳转代码实现方法,通过学习本文,开发者可以轻松掌握这一技术,并将其应用到实际项目中,提高用户体验,在实际应用中,可以根据需求对代码进行优化和扩展,以满足更多场景的需求。
标签: #指定关键词跳转代码
评论列表